A Retail Radeon 64MB VIVO is available for $150. A Retail Radeon AIW can be found for $160 on-line. All the AIW gets you versus the VIVO is the TV tuner/TIVO/Guide+ functions. The new AIW Radeon 8500 DV should be available at $420 shortly. the 8500DV has Firewire capability, a remote control, a faster GPU, etc.

I guess it depends partly on how much you want to pay.

Go with the AIW, but only if you plan on capturing to low-res (352x240) since the AIW doesn't have hardware compression. You would need 1Ghz+ to capture at 720x480 using the ATI software. NewEgg has the retail version for $159
